Even casual tennis fans have likely heard the name cori “Coco” Gauff. Heralded early in her career as the next Serena Williams, Gauff has navigated immense pressure and expectations to forge her own path to greatness.
Gauff’s early success was undeniable. Winning the junior title at Roland Garros at just 14 years old is a feat few achieve. Then, at 15, she burst onto the scene at Wimbledon 2019, defeating Venus williams and reaching the fourth round. This victory instantly catapulted her into the global spotlight.
While comparisons to Serena Williams were unavoidable, Gauff’s journey has been uniquely her own. I’m not trying to be the next anyone. I’m only trying to be Coco Gauff,
she stated in a post-match interview at the 2023 US Open, emphasizing her desire to carve her own legacy.
The American tennis landscape has seen its share of Grand Slam champions, but Gauff’s trajectory has always felt different. The weight of expectation was immense, with many anticipating a Grand Slam title before she even turned 18. While that didn’t happen, her victory at the US Open 2023 at 19 years old silenced many doubters.Now, at 21, her Roland Garros 2025 triumph solidifies her status as a dominant force in women’s tennis.

Roland Garros Triumph: Overcoming Adversity
gauff’s roland Garros victory was notably notable, considering she dropped the first set in the final. Her ability to regroup and dominate the subsequent sets demonstrates her mental fortitude and adaptability – qualities essential for sustained success in professional tennis. Mastering the Unteachable: Mental Toughness
In both of her Grand Slam title victories, Gauff faced Aryna Sabalenka in the final. The Roland Garros final, lasting over 2.5 hours, was a grueling contest marked by intense rallies.While Sabalenka’s 70 unforced errors are noteworthy,focusing solely on that statistic would be a disservice to the overall quality of the match. Gauff ultimately prevailed with a score of 6-7(5), 6-2, 6-4.
One could argue that Gauff’s victory was built upon her ability to capitalize on Sabalenka’s errors. Though, it’s more accurate to say that Gauff’s consistent pressure and strategic shot selection forced those errors. Her court coverage, tactical awareness, and unwavering focus proved to be the difference-makers.

What are Coco Gauff’s major achievements so far?
Coco Gauff has secured two Grand Slam titles at the time of this writing: The US Open in 2023, and Roland Garros in 2025 in women’s singles. Additionally,she has reached multiple Grand Slam finals and has won several WTA titles,marking her as a formidable competitor.
-
How did Coco Gauff become famous?
Gauff rapidly gained recognition at a young age, particularly when she reached the fourth round of Wimbledon in 2019 at just 15 years old, defeating Venus Williams. Her junior Roland Garros title and continued success in professional tournaments amplified her fame.
